Deploying the right employee engagement software can help you increase productivity, improve retention rates, and even boost your bottom line. What is employee engagement software? Employee engagement software can be any number of tools that allow employers to measure and improve employee engagement.

6 SharePoint Alternatives to Consider for Effective Employee Communications

Staffbase

That’s because SharePoint’s inherent design isn’t geared towards being a simple, intuitive, and engaging communication hub, which presents several challenges for communicators. Some key challenges of using SharePoint for communications include: A poor mobile experience that can significantly hinder employee engagement.
